When minor surface stains are not addressed and removed in a timely manner, they will inevitably start to penetrate deeper and deeper into the tooth enamel. In time, this could leave you with a dull, yellow smile that can’t be effectively whitened by the whitening products sold on store shelves.

For teeth this severely afflicted with stains, you will need to seek professional whitening measures. Fortunately, Dr. Sam Cigno can perform a dental bleaching treatment to safely restore your white smile.

The professional-strength dental bleach he uses is very potent. So, he will take measures to protect your gums by installing a soft rubber dam or by applying a protective gel before the dental bleaching treatment.

Your dentist will then pour a small amount of the concentrated bleaching gel into a tray that is inserted into your mouth. It will need to be held in place for a few minutes. The total duration of the treatment will vary depending on the severity of your tooth stains.

Once this is completed, he might use a special ultraviolet light to brighten any troubled spots and improve the luster of your smile.

After your white smile has been fully restored, you might want to consider cutting back on dark foods and beverages to prevent future stains. Brushing your teeth with a whitening toothpaste that has been approved by the American Dental Association could also help remove future surface stains.
